This part of Norwell, Massachusetts offers a convenient location for senior living with easy access to essential services such as pharmacies, hospitals, and physicians. There are multiple options for pharmacies nearby, including CVS Pharmacy and Walgreens, ensuring that medications are easily accessible. In terms of healthcare, South Shore Hospital and Signature Health Care are within a short distance. For recreational activities, there are several parks in the area such as Great Esker Park and Bare Cove Park, providing opportunities for outdoor exercise and relaxation. Additionally, there are cafes like Starbucks and restaurants like Chick-Fil-A and K C's Pub & Grill for socializing and dining out. With transportation options like the West Hingham Commuter Rail Station nearby, residents can easily explore other parts of the area. Overall, this part of Norwell offers a blend of convenience, healthcare services, recreational opportunities, and community amenities suitable for senior living.

Managing Nursing Home Expenses After Medicare Coverage Ends
Medicare provides limited coverage for skilled nursing home care, covering full benefits for the first 20 days and partial benefits up to 100 days under certain conditions, after which families must explore alternative funding options like Medicaid or long-term care insurance to manage potentially high costs. Proactive planning is essential to navigate the complexities of financing ongoing care once Medicare coverage ends.
